Abstract
A patented test facility has been developed for the purpose of analyzing exhaust noise emissions. The facility isolates the exhaust system noise source and allows noise tests to be conducted under the SAE J366a test site conditions.
The exhaust system is piped and positioned in a manner similar to that found on the vehicle. Noise tests are conducted under steady state engine speed and load settings resulting in a high repeatability of test data.
